Sunroof shattered. Questions on replaceing??
While on a cross-country trip from AZ to GA, my sunroof was shattered while driving through Oklahoma City. I have no idea if it just let go or something hit it, didn't see anything on my dash cam. I have never dealt with Sunroof systems much in the past so my question is can just the glass panel be removed and replaced or does the whole rack sliding mechanism have to be replaced? I have the one moving glass panel sunroof, not panoramic

I believe the glass sunroof is an individual part that can be ordered - part number 95856407100
I would probably have the dealership do this for me, as there is probably a lot of work to get it out and reinstalled (like removing the headliner), and then reprogrammed to start/stop in the correct places, etc.
